Correct Answer: Option **A** **Explanation:** To determine the tax payable under the Reverse Charge Mechanism (RCM), let us evaluate the inward services received by Sandeep:
1. **Hiring of a bus from Ravi:** - Hired a bus from Ravi (registered in Maharashtra) for ₹ 50,000. - Under Section 9(3) of the CGST Act, 2017, RCM on renting of passenger motor vehicles applies only when the supplier is a non-body corporate and the recipient is a body corporate. - Since Sandeep is an individual (not a body corporate), RCM provisions are not applicable here. Tax is payable under forward charge by the supplier, Ravi.
2. **Security services from Protect You Security Limited:** - Security services were received for ₹ 35,000. - Under Section 9(3) of the CGST Act, 2017, RCM on security services (supply of security personnel) is applicable only when the supplier is any person other than a body corporate and the recipient is a registered person. - Since the supplier is "Protect You Security Limited" (a body corporate), RCM is not applicable. The tax is payable under forward charge by the supplier.
3. **Conclusion:** As none of the inward services fall under RCM for Sandeep, the amount on which he is required to pay tax under RCM is ₹ 0. Hence, **Option A** is the correct answer.
